Output 15417caf35ea603294a77bf6032c9f0d951a071e7bc31997041d23651b57ac8d:7

value
313666
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0668c521980d02b21dbc5aaf638c676aa9e391dd OP_EQUALVERIFY OP_CHECKSIG
address
1atZhfzzySXy7WgVrMyeqtBt6Mr4yMaiL
transaction
15417caf35ea603294a77bf6032c9f0d951a071e7bc31997041d23651b57ac8d